The impact of Internet gambling on problem gamblers
A variety of studies have shown an increase in risk of gambling problems among those who gamble on Internet gambling, but little research has looked into the risk factors that affect those who gamble online and the general involvement in gambling. A study in Australia that involved 3178 gamblers who were struggling. It included a questionnaire which measured gambling involvement, severity, and seeking help. Researchers discovered that Internet gamblers were more likely to engage in gambling than non-gamblers. They also had higher problem gambling severity scores.
Despite differences in the findings from different studies, the general number problem gamblers increased. The proportion of people reporting increased gambling on the internet in four of the four studies was between four and fourteen percent. However, this finding is not likely to be exact due to the method used. Researchers used social media to solicit participants as well as unweighted online panels for data collection. However, these methods are not ideal for estimating the prevalence of Internet gambling among people who are addicted to gambling.
